Revamp[edit]

Hi. I'm the one who recently revamped the template. I am changing a couple of elements back to how I had them. I had originally intended to make the subheadings blue, as has now been done by someone else, using the secondary color in the same way I used Penn's red at {{Penn}}. After previewing, though, I found UFL's official shade of blue was way too close to the default unclicked-link color in used in most browsers, and might prove confusing to a reader. Orange just wasn't as readable as I would have liked. I am changing the subheadings back to dark grey.

I selected the white-on-orange header color scheme based on the page headers at the UFL website and the content of these pages: http://identity.ufl.edu/signatureSystem/ and http://identity.ufl.edu/web/. Blue text on orange and, to an extent, vice vera are hard on the eyes and relatively difficult to read, which is probably why UFL seems to avoid the combination on its website, instead opting for white text on blue or orange. Since orange is a much more unique color amongst colleges than blue, I used that as the field color, and just made the widgets in the top corners blue.
